(1 point) A phone-in poll conducted by a newspaper reported that 72% of those who called in liked ''real TV''. (a) The number 72% is a A. population. B. sample. C. parameter. D. statistic. (b) The unknown true percentage of American citizens who like ''real TV'' is a A. sample. B. statistic. C. parameter. D. population.\
(a) The number 72% is a D. statistic.
(b) The unknown true percentage of American citizens who like ''real TV'' is a C. parameter.
How to know about the state of the number 72%?It is related to statistics and parameters.
(a) The number 72% is a statistic because it represents a summary measure of the sample of individuals who participated in the phone-in poll.
A statistic is a numerical value calculated from a sample of data, and it is used to make inferences about the population from which the sample was drawn.
How to know about the unknown true percentage of American citizens who like ''real TV''?(b) The unknown true percentage of American citizens who like ''real TV'' is a parameter.
A parameter is a numerical characteristic of a population, such as a mean, proportion, or standard deviation, and it is typically unknown and estimated from sample data.
In this case, the percentage of all American citizens who like ''real TV'' is unknown and cannot be directly observed, so it is considered a parameter.
The phone-in poll only represents a sample of individuals who called in to the newspaper and cannot be used to estimate the parameter for the entire population.

A rigid transformation preserves size and shape of a figure, so the image is congruent to the original. The rigid transformations are rotation, reflection, and translation. Each has characteristics that allow one to determine the nature of the transformation(s) involved.
__
rotationangle and direction
One way to determine the angle and direction of rotation of a figure is to compare a horizontal segment on the original with the corresponding segment on the image. Here, a convenient segment is NM, which is horizontal and points to the right. Its angle relative to the direction of the +x axis is 0°.
The transformed segment N'M' points upward, at an angle relative to the +x axis of 90°. This tells you the figure was rotated 90° in the CCW direction. (This is fully equivalent to a rotation of 270° in the CW direction.)
center
Points in a rotated image always remain at the same distance from the center of rotation as the original points. In most cases, the center of rotation is the origin. We can check to see if that is the case by looking at the distances of a couple of points from the origin.
N is at coordinates (1, 1), so is √(1² +1²) = √2 from the origin
N' is at coordinates (-1, 1), so is √((-1)² +1²) = √2 from the origin
L is at coordinates (1, 3), so is √(1² +3²) = √10 from the origin
L' is at coordinates (-3, 1) so is √((-3)² +1²) = √10 from the origin
This confirms that the origin is the center of rotation.
__
Since each point and its image are on a circle centered at the center of rotation, the line between them is a chord of that circle. The perpendicular bisector of that chord goes through the center of rotation. Here, we observe that the perpendicular bisector of NN' is the y-axis. The perpendicular bisector of LL' is a line with slope -2 through (-1, 2). It will intersect the y-axis at the origin, confirming the origin as the center of rotation.

find the distance from the point (6, 1, −1) to the plane x − 2y 2z 1 = 0.
The distance from the point (6, 1, -1) to the plane x - 2y + 2z + 1 = 0 is 1 unit.
To find the distance from a point to a plane, we can use the formula for the distance between a point and a plane.
Let's denote the given point as P(6, 1, -1) and the equation of the plane as Ax + By + Cz + D = 0, where A, B, C, and D are the coefficients of the plane equation.
The formula for the distance (d) between a point (x0, y0, z0) and a plane Ax + By + Cz + D = 0 is:
d = |Ax0 + By0 + Cz0 + D| / √(A² + B² + C²)
In this case, the equation of the plane is x - 2y + 2z + 1 = 0, which can be written as 1x - 2y + 2z + 1 = 0.
Comparing coefficients, we have:
A = 1
B = -2
C = 2
D = 1
Substituting the values into the distance formula, we get:
d = |1(6) + (-2)(1) + 2(-1) + 1| / √(1² + (-2)² + 2²)
= |6 - 2 - 2 + 1| / √(1 + 4 + 4)
= |3| / √(9)
= 3 / 3
= 1
Therefore, the distance from the point (6, 1, -1) to the plane x - 2y + 2z + 1 = 0 is 1 unit.
